UpdatePackageAsync fails with FileNotFoundException
Hi everyone, I'm trying to update an MSIX installed .netcore3.1 application using the Windows.Management.Deployment.PackageManager), with the following source code: var installTask = packageman...
MikeH
Dec 23, 2021Brass Contributor
Ideas:
1. Do you see any attempt to contact the server in your server logs at all?
2. Does the URI contain any weird characters or other things that could be confusing it?
3. Does the URI point to an .appinstaller file (might be broken at the moment by the ms-appinstaller:// screwups) or an MSIX file? Try both?
